Indoor playgrounds are a smart stop when the weather turns — Brooklyn Heights has a reliable option right here. NY Kids Club on Henry Street gives kids room to climb, jump, and burn energy without the usual park runaround. Art projects, music sessions, and movement classes keep little ones engaged while giving caregivers a breather. Weekday mornings often feel calmer than after-school rushes, so timing your visit can make the difference. The spot sits at 182 Henry St, Brooklyn, NY 11201 — easy to pair with a coffee run or errands nearby. Parents can drop in for open play or check the schedule for themed days that shift with the season. Toddler zones stay separate from bigger-kid areas so no one feels crowded. It’s designed to feel spacious even when it’s busy, a small mercy on busy days. Planning your first trip is as simple as dialing (718) 355-8215 to confirm which sessions still have space. They often update availability mid-week, so a quick call saves a trip if the roster’s full. Birthday parties and special events book fast, so if that’s the goal, early notice is your best ally.
